Kolkata is a mesmerizing city located on the east coast of India. The capital of the modern Indian state of West Bengal, Kolkata was also the capital of the erstwhile British Empire. The entire city is dotted with beautiful Victorian Era architectural buildings. The culture, the people, Aroma of tea and coffee oozing Hindi error of Kolkata will leave a mark on your memory. There are many tourist attractions in Kolkata, let's have a look at some of them.
Indian Museum - The museum that has recently celebrated its bicentenary. The Indian museum holds some of the most bizarre artifacts that you will find in a museum. The artifacts stored in this museum consist of things like a human embryo, an Egyptian mummy and also artifacts from prehistoric times. Built by the British, the Indian Museum is a beautiful example of colonial architecture with huge buildings sitting in between palatial gardens.
Tagore House - A Nobel laureate, Rabindranath Tagore was an iconic Indian poet who lived during British India. This is the same man who penned the Indian National anthem and is highly regarded all over the world for his poetic feats. The Tagore House is a stately mansion built in the 18th century by the Tagore family. You can find here are works of Rabindranath Tagore and also famous photographs like the one in which Rabindranath Tagore is standing with Albert Einstein.
Botanical Gardens - Built by the British in 1786 and today these gardens house some 12000 plant species, some of which are rarely found anywhere else. The garden has a cactus collection, palm collection, and a splendid water lily collection. Feel free to let your mind wander in the close affinity of these wonderful plant species. The botanical gardens of Kolkata are surely one of the most famous tourist destinations in Kolkata.
Victoria memorial - The most iconic building of Kolkata was built by Lord Curzon in memory of Queen Victoria. The generous use of marble makes this beautiful structure matchless. It is one of the famous tourist places in Kolkata. The view of the Victoria memorial is a bedazzling one from the outside as the quiet ponds provide a wonderful photographic shot when viewed from a distance.
When inside the memorial do not forget to pay a visit to the Calcutta Gallery, which is a good exhibition of paintings and other artifacts from the colonial era. These paintings will give you a glimpse of Kolkata's heydays.
Kalighat Temple - One of the most important tourist spots near Kolkata, the Kalighat Temple is an important religious shrine dedicated to goddess Kali. Considered to be a Shakti Peeth, the Kalighat Temple is a mesmerizing amalgamation of religion and splendid architecture. Each year millions of pilgrims from all over Bengal come to this temple during special occasions like Durga Puja.
